Timur's lash vs fatebringer

Timur's lash: Level 28 guardian hitting a red bar 28 does 1665 precision. One hits basic enemies, two hits the knights. Body shots hit 555. This two hits basic enemies. Level 30 guardian in hard raid: Does 1338 precision damage to major goblins. This is a two shot kill to hobgoblins and goblins. If you do a precision shot, it will take 3 more body shots to finish the goblin off. For normal redbar goblins, precision damage will be 1665. This will get them to about 5% health and a single body shot will finish the job. Crucible: hits 95 to the head, it is a 3 shot but after the second headshot they are about 10% health. Hits 64 to the body. And takes 4 body shots to kill. If you hit one headshot it will take another two body shots to kill. Something to note: on mine I have a perk where reloading after a kill gives a short damage bonus. This makes headshots do 127 and will two shot kill Fatebringer: Level 28 guardian killing level 28 enemies Precision damage is 1505. Body shots hit for 502. This makes it a 1 shot headshot on normal enemies, two shot body shot. Upon getting a headshot, you proc firefly. Firefly does 1062 damage to the surrounding enemies and will either 1 shot them or get them to a 1 shot body shot (for enemies like (hobgoblins) Level 30 guardian in hard raid: On red bar goblins it is a 1505 for precision damage, making it a 1 shot body shot afterwards. On major goblins it hits 1254 precision and will two shot with precision damage. If you hit one precision shot it will take 3 body shots to finish them off. Crucible: Hits 84 precision damage. Also is a 3 shot to the head and if you hit 1 headshot it will take two body shots to kill. All bodyshots is a 4 shot to kill Final conclusion: Fatebringer is better is almost every way. It takes the same amount of shots to kill as the Timur's lash on most enemies, aside from some very high health majors. In addition, fatebringer has decent recoil and a 12 round "magazine" by default. With the timur's lash, you have to pick from a 13 round magaize or have low recoil. Without field scout you have 7 rounds and this is extremely low. One thing to note about the Timur's lash is if you process Reactive Reload, you will get two shot kills in crucible.
